Time Constant Setting for Timer-Latch Short-Circuit
Protection Circuit
The time constant for timer-latch short-circuit protection
is set by the capacitor CSCP and determined as the fol-
lowing equation :
tPE (S) = 0.70 CSCP ( µF)
Dead-Time Setting
The dead-time control pin (DTC) is designed to set the
maximum ON duty of the main-side MOSFET. When the
device is set for step-up inverted output based on the
step-up or step-up/down Zeta method or flyback method,
the FB pin voltage may reach and exceed the triangular
wave voltage due to load fluctuation. If this is the case, the
output MOSFET is fixed to a ON duty of 100 %. To prevent
this, set the maximum duty of the output MOSFET. Con-
necting a resistor- divider between VREF, DTC and GND
pins provides a voltage VDTC to DTC pin. When the the
voltage at the DTC pin is higher than the triangular wave
voltage (CT1/2), the output transistor is turned on. The
maximum duty is calculated as the following equation:
